The cooling assembly should be cleaned once
every two months to insure optimal perform-
ance.
To flush the system:
1. Open the door and remove the heat trans-
fer fluid bottle.
2. Empty the contents and fill the bottle
halfway with a solution of 1:5 bleach in
distilled water.
3. Replace the bottle and insert only the tube
with the filter (A). Completely immerse
the filter in the fluid.
4. Insert the return tube (B) into another
container.
5. If there is a Supervisor/Operator
keyswitch, turn it to the Supervisor posi-
tion.
6. Press TEST to enter the test menu. Press
< or > to select "Head Up Down Test"
and press START.
7. Insert an empty sample tube into the
freezing chamber and press START.
8. Run this test for 10-15 minutes and then
press STOP.
Note: Using the manual primer pump to
complement the head pumping action
can help reduce the time required to
flush the system.
9. Remove the bottle with the diluted bleach
and install a new bottle of heat transfer
fluid. Insert only the tube with the filter
(A).
10. Press START twice. Run this test until
the colored fluid begins draining out of
the return tube, and then press STOP.
11. Remove the return tube from the contain-
er and insert it into the heat transfer fluid
bottle. Do not immerse the return tube in
the heat transfer fluid (B).
12 Press STOP to exit the menu.
To drain the system:
1. Turn off the power and unplug the instru-
ment. Remove the cover.
2. Remove the heat transfer fluid bottle and
empty the contents.
3. Replace the empty bottle and insert the
tubes.
4. Press gently on the pump at the bottom of
the head. Slide until all liquid has been
expelled (the unit may need to be tipped
on its side to remove the liquid).
